San Diego Christian College vs. Howard Payne University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, San Diego Christian College or Howard Payne University?

  • Howard Payne University is 20.5% more expensive to attend than San Diego Christian College for in-state tuition ($29,522.00 vs. $24,500.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 20.5% higher at Howard Payne University than San Diego Christian College ($29,522.00 vs. $24,500.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Howard Payne University than San Diego Christian College ($25,768 vs. $26,979)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Howard Payne University are 10% lower than costs at San Diego Christian College ($10,074 vs. $11,080)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at San Diego Christian College than Howard Payne University (100% vs. 91%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Howard Payne University students is 64.1% larger than aid received San Diego Christian College ($18,957 vs. $11,554)

San Diego Christian College vs. Howard Payne University Admissions Difficulty Comparison

Which college is harder to get into, San Diego Christian College or Howard Payne University? Average SAT and ACT scores plus acceptance rates offer good insight into the difficulty of admission between Howard Payne University or San Diego Christian College .

  • The average SAT score at Howard Payne University (965) is 32 points higher than at San Diego Christian College (933)
  • Incoming Howard Payne University students have a 1 point higher average ACT score (21) than students at San Diego Christian College (20)
  • Accepted freshman Howard Payne University students have a 0.04 point higher average high school GPA (3.3) than students at San Diego Christian College (3.26)
  • Howard Payne University has a higher acceptance rate (67.7%) than San Diego Christian College (62.8%)

San Diego Christian College vs. Howard Payne University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, San Diego Christian College or Howard Payne University?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between Howard Payne University and San Diego Christian College.

  • The graduation rate at Howard Payne University is higher than San Diego Christian College (46% vs. 31%)
  • Graduates from Howard Payne University earn on average $800 more per year than San Diego Christian College graduates after ten years. ($40,300 vs. $39,500)
  • San Diego Christian College students graduate with a $2,580 lower median federal student loan debt than Howard Payne University graduates. ($23,106 vs. $25,686)
  • San Diego Christian College graduates are paying $27 less per month on federal student loans than Howard Payne University graduates. ($238 vs. $265)
  • More Howard Payne University gra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former San Diego Christian College students, three years after graduation. (58% vs. 47%)
